Removed goto

This commit is contained in:
Michael K 2014-11-26 16:21:39 +01:00
parent e1d228914f
commit 2ffad35d97
1 changed files with 4 additions and 7 deletions

View File

@ -294,15 +294,12 @@ func (this *Feed) testVersions() bool {
func (this *Feed) GetVersionInfo(doc *xmlx.Document) (ftype string, fversion [2]int) { func (this *Feed) GetVersionInfo(doc *xmlx.Document) (ftype string, fversion [2]int) {
var node *xmlx.Node var node *xmlx.Node
if node = doc.SelectNode("http://www.w3.org/2005/Atom", "feed"); node == nil { if node = doc.SelectNode("http://www.w3.org/2005/Atom", "feed"); node != nil {
goto rss
}
ftype = "atom" ftype = "atom"
fversion = [2]int{1, 0} fversion = [2]int{1, 0}
return return
}
rss:
if node = doc.SelectNode("", "rss"); node != nil { if node = doc.SelectNode("", "rss"); node != nil {
ftype = "rss" ftype = "rss"
major := 0 major := 0